Output 5b3d13ca1171e0dcc93a3d893196b256300811c59144dcc079b4da7e09d1d690:4

value
2568296223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493b2c5e482850ae0e54e29caa748d676514c5df OP_EQUAL
address
38NE8ysHrFZyHqQSoDNH39qRBLzQoYpF3L
transaction
5b3d13ca1171e0dcc93a3d893196b256300811c59144dcc079b4da7e09d1d690
spent
true